Vyksa weather in January (Nizhny Novgorod Oblast, Russia)
What can you expect from the weather in Vyksa during January? Here's what the weather might have in store during this month.
In January, Vyksa generally has very low temperatures and moderate snowfall. January is a winter month. Throughout the daytime, temperatures often hover around -4°C. However, as the sun sets and evening approaches, there's a noticeable cool-down, with temperatures gently dropping to a more temperate -11°C. Typically, it's the chilliest month of the year. Ensure you're prepared by packing appropriate winter gear.
Vyksa in January usually receives moderate snowfall, averaging around 48 mm for the month. Delving into the climate records from the past 30 years, one can predict that nearly 19 days of the month will see snowfall.
If you're looking for dry conditions and comfortable temperatures, January may not be the ideal month to visit Vyksa. May, June, July and August typically offer the best circumstances. While January, February, March, October, November and December tend to showcase less optimal conditions.
